How to Get Here

We are located at the corner of Peel and de la Gauchetière streets, right behind the former SNC-Lavallin building. We are close to:

–  Place du Canada on the Eastern side;

–  Former Windsor Station on the Southern side;

–  The IBM - Marathon Building on the Western side.

Map showing the location of St. George's Church

Coming by Metro

The church is located on the Orange line (line 2).

–  Exit at the Bonaventure station.

–  As there are many exits, follow signs to Gare Lucien-Lallier • Centre Bell.

–  Exit at the first door (otherwise you would go towards the IBM - Marathon Building).
(Access to the IBM Building is generally closed on Sundays.)

–  Cross the street to enter the church.

If you prefer to travel on the Green line (line 1), the closest access is Peel station (exit via Stanley Street). Walk 3 blocks South.

Coming by Bus

The church is located near the following bus lines: 107, 150 (infrequent service), 358 (nighttime service).
On weekdays, it is also served by the following rush-hour buses: 74, 75, 410, 420, 430, 535.

Coming by Car

As it is a downtown church, you will have to account for downtown traffic and parking restrictions. On-street parking is generally not too bad on Sunday mornings, unless there is a parade or another special event... which happens quite a few times per year.
